// Copyright 2022 David Conran
#include "IRac.h"
#include "IRrecv.h"
#include "IRrecv_test.h"
#include "IRsend.h"
#include "IRsend_test.h"
#include "gtest/gtest.h"
TEST(TestUtils, Housekeeping) {
ASSERT_EQ("WOWWEE", typeToString(decode_type_t::WOWWEE));
ASSERT_EQ(decode_type_t::WOWWEE, strToDecodeType("WOWWEE"));
ASSERT_FALSE(hasACState(decode_type_t::WOWWEE));
ASSERT_FALSE(IRac::isProtocolSupported(decode_type_t::WOWWEE));
ASSERT_EQ(kWowweeBits, IRsend::defaultBits(decode_type_t::WOWWEE));
ASSERT_EQ(kWowweeDefaultRepeat, IRsend::minRepeats(decode_type_t::WOWWEE));
}
// Tests for sendWowwee().
// Test sending typical data only.
TEST(TestSendWowwee, SendDataOnly) {
IRsendTest irsend(kGpioUnused);
irsend.begin();
irsend.reset();
irsend.sendWowwee(0x186); // Nikai TV Power Off.
EXPECT_EQ(
"f38000d33"
"m6684s723"
"m912s723m912s723m912s3259m912s3259m912s723m912s723m912s723m912s723"
"m912s3259m912s3259m912s723m912s100000",
irsend.outputStr());
irsend.reset();
}
// Tests for decodeWowwee().
// Decode normal Wowwee messages.
TEST(TestDecodeWowwee, RealDecode) {
IRsendTest irsend(kGpioUnused);
IRrecv irrecv(kGpioUnused);
irsend.begin();
// Ref: https://github.com/crankyoldgit/IRremoteESP8266/issues/1938#issue-1513240242
const uint16_t rawForward[25] = {
6684, 740, 918, 724, 942, 724, 918, 3250, 870, 3268, 872, 770, 940, 690,
942, 688, 942, 738, 942, 3250, 868, 3268, 872, 732, 918
}; // UNKNOWN 7469BF81
irsend.reset();
irsend.sendRaw(rawForward, 25, 38);
irsend.makeDecodeResult();
ASSERT_TRUE(irrecv.decode(&irsend.capture));
EXPECT_EQ(decode_type_t::WOWWEE, irsend.capture.decode_type);
EXPECT_EQ(kWowweeBits, irsend.capture.bits);
EXPECT_EQ(0x186, irsend.capture.value);
EXPECT_EQ(0x0, irsend.capture.command);
EXPECT_EQ(0x0, irsend.capture.address);
// Ref: https://github.com/crankyoldgit/IRremoteESP8266/issues/1938#issue-1513240242
const uint16_t rawLeft[25] = {
6630, 764, 868, 762, 892, 788, 866, 3324, 792, 3348, 818, 760, 866, 788,
894, 772, 892, 750, 870, 786, 920, 750, 864, 776, 868
}; // UNKNOWN 28A1120F
irsend.reset();
irsend.sendRaw(rawLeft, 25, 38);
irsend.makeDecodeResult();
ASSERT_TRUE(irrecv.decode(&irsend.capture));
EXPECT_EQ(decode_type_t::WOWWEE, irsend.capture.decode_type);
EXPECT_EQ(kWowweeBits, irsend.capture.bits);
EXPECT_EQ(0x180, irsend.capture.value);
EXPECT_EQ(0x0, irsend.capture.command);
EXPECT_EQ(0x0, irsend.capture.address);
}
// Decode normal repeated Wowwee messages.
TEST(TestDecodeWowwee, SyntheticDecode) {
IRsendTest irsend(kGpioUnused);
IRrecv irrecv(kGpioUnused);
irsend.begin();
// Normal Wowwee 11-bit message.
irsend.reset();
irsend.sendWowwee(0x186);
irsend.makeDecodeResult();
ASSERT_TRUE(irrecv.decode(&irsend.capture));
EXPECT_EQ(decode_type_t::WOWWEE, irsend.capture.decode_type);
EXPECT_EQ(kWowweeBits, irsend.capture.bits);
EXPECT_EQ(0x186, irsend.capture.value);
EXPECT_EQ(0x0, irsend.capture.command);
EXPECT_EQ(0x0, irsend.capture.address);
// Normal Wowwee 11-bit message.
irsend.reset();
irsend.sendWowwee(0x180);
irsend.makeDecodeResult();
ASSERT_TRUE(irrecv.decode(&irsend.capture));
EXPECT_EQ(decode_type_t::WOWWEE, irsend.capture.decode_type);
EXPECT_EQ(kWowweeBits, irsend.capture.bits);
EXPECT_EQ(0x180, irsend.capture.value);
EXPECT_EQ(0x0, irsend.capture.command);
EXPECT_EQ(0x0, irsend.capture.address);
}
